Egress window installation involves adding a specialized window that provides a safe and accessible exit point from a basement or below-grade living space. These windows are designed to meet specific size and operational requirements, ensuring they can serve as an emergency escape route in case of fire or other emergencies. The process typically includes cutting into the foundation or wall, installing a new window well or exterior drainage system, and ensuring the window opens easily from the inside. Proper installation is essential to meet safety standards and to prevent water infiltration or structural issues.

This service helps address safety concerns associated with below-ground living areas, especially in homes where the basement functions as a primary living space. Without an adequate egress window, residents may face difficulties escaping during emergencies, and local building codes often require such windows for finished basements. Additionally, egress windows can improve natural light and ventilation, making basement areas more livable and comfortable. Properly installed egress windows also help prevent issues related to moisture and mold by facilitating better airflow and water drainage.

Properties that typically utilize egress window installation include residential homes with finished basements, basement apartments, and multi-family buildings. Older homes undergoing renovation or remodeling often need to add egress windows to comply with updated safety codes. New construction projects also incorporate these windows from the outset to ensure safety and code compliance. Commercial properties with below-ground spaces may also require egress windows, particularly if those areas are used as living or working spaces, to meet safety standards and provide emergency exits.

Material and Window Type - The cost of egress window installation varies based on the materials and window style chosen. Typical prices range from $2,000 to $5,000, depending on the size and type of window selected.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ific preferences and needs.

Labor and Permitting - Labor costs for installation generally range from $1,500 to $4,000, influenced by the complexity of the project. Permitting fees may add an additional $100 to $500, depending on local regulations and requirements.

Excavation and Site Preparation - Site preparation, including excavation and foundation work, can cost between $1,000 and $3,500. The price varies based on soil conditions and accessibility of the installation area.

Additional Features and Finishing - Finishing touches such as window wells, grading, and interior framing can add $500 to $2,500 to the overall cost. These options enhance safety and aesthetic appeal, with prices depending on scope and materials used.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is an egress window? An egress window is a large window designed to provide a safe exit in case of emergencies, often required in basement bedrooms or living spaces.

Are egress window installations permitted in residential basements? Yes, local building codes typically require egress windows in basement bedrooms and habitable spaces for safety reasons.

How long does an egress window installation usually take? The installation duration can vary depending on the project scope and site conditions, but generally it takes one to several days.

Can existing windows be converted into egress windows? Sometimes existing windows can be modified to meet egress requirements, but many projects involve installing new, compliant windows.

What factors influence the cost of egress window installation? Costs depend on window size, type, excavation requirements, and local labor rates, with a consultation needed for accurate estimates.
